Skip to main content
SnapManager Oracle
La versione in lingua italiana fornita proviene da una traduzione automatica. Per eventuali incoerenze, fare riferimento alla versione in lingua inglese.

Il comando smo repository delete

Collaboratori

Questo comando elimina un repository utilizzato per memorizzare i profili di database e le credenziali associate. È possibile eliminare un repository solo se non sono presenti profili nel repository.

Sintassi

        smo repository delete
-repository
-port repo_port
-dbname repo_service_name
-host repo_host
-login -username repo_username
[-force] [-noprompt]
[-quiet | -verbose]

Parametri

  • -repository

    Le opzioni che seguono -repository specificano i dettagli del database per il repository.

  • -port repo_port

    Specifica il numero di porta TCP utilizzato per accedere al database in cui è memorizzato il repository.

  • -dbname repo_service_name

    Specifica il nome del database in cui è memorizzato il repository. Utilizzare il nome globale o il SID.

  • -host repo_host

    Specifica il nome o l'indirizzo IP del computer host su cui viene eseguito il database del repository.

  • -login

    Avvia i dettagli di accesso al repository.

  • -nome utente repo_nome utente

    Specifica il nome utente necessario per accedere al database in cui è memorizzato il repository.

  • -force

    Tenta di forzare l'eliminazione del repository, anche in caso di operazioni incomplete. In caso di operazioni incomplete, SnapManager visualizza un messaggio che chiede se si è sicuri di voler eliminare il repository.

  • -noprompt

    Non richiede prima di eliminare il repository. L'opzione -noprompt consente di evitare la visualizzazione del prompt, semplificando l'eliminazione dei repository mediante uno script.

  • -quiet

    Visualizza solo i messaggi di errore sulla console. L'impostazione predefinita prevede la visualizzazione dei messaggi di errore e di avviso.

  • -dettagliato

    Visualizza messaggi di errore, di avviso e informativi sulla console.

Esempio di comando

Nell'esempio seguente viene eliminato il repository nel database SALESDB.

smo repository delete -repository -port 1521 -dbname smorep
-host nila -login -username smofresno -force -verbose
This command will delete repository "smofresno@smorep/nila".
Any resources maintained by the repository must be cleaned up manually.
This may include snapshots, mounted backups, and clones.
Are you sure you wish to proceed (Y/N)?Y
[ INFO] SMO-09201: Dropping existing schema as smofresno
  on jdbc:oracle:thin:@//nila:1521/smorep.
[ INFO] SMO-13048: Repository Delete Operation Status: SUCCESS
[ INFO] SMO-13049: Elapsed Time: 0:00:06.372
[ INFO] SMO-20010: Synchronizing mapping for profiles in
   repository "smofresno@smorep/nila:1521".
[ WARN] SMO-20029: No repository schema exists in "smofresno@smorep/nila:1521".
 Deleting all profile mappings for this repository.
[ INFO] SMO-20012: Deleted stale mapping for profile "TESTPASS".